Summary

The final Top247 for the class of 2020 was released earlier today. Ohio State's haul now includes four 5-star commitments. The 5-star Reveal Show show, hosted by Josh Pate and featuring analysis from 247Sports Director of Scouting Barton Simmons, featured player-by-player unveiling of the 32 final 5-star prospects in the class of 2020. That means in-depth discussion on the two you knew about and the newest 5-star Buckeyes: No. 4 Julian Fleming; No. 8 Paris Jackson, Jr.; No. 15 Jackson Smith-Njigba; No. 29 C.J. Stroud. So it back and listen to Josh and Barton go into detail on each of the Buckeyes to earn such lofty status and stick around for a list of the five prospects that fell just short of that elusive fifth star.
